Aqua beads Jewel Starter Set Review

27 July 2014 by Eileen

The Jewel Starter Set is the perfect set for new Aqua beaders. It comes with simple templates to follow and it lets you create all kinds of creatures and objects. Aqua beads are small plastic beads which can be used to make pictures and then you use water to fuse them together to make the design in 2D or 3D.

Aqua beads Jewel Starter Set review

Inside the box, it comes with:

  • Over 800 jewel beads
  • 5 template sheets
  • Bead case
  • Layout tray
  • Base tray
  • Sprayer
  • Bead pen
  • Instructions

This set comes with an amazing 800 beads and a plastic bead case to display the beads. There is also a handy bead placer included, making it even easier to create detailed designs. My son had no problems using the placer to place the beads onto the layout tray. Occasionally, the beads falls off the placer or the beads move to another gap after placing it but generally, they are easy to place.

aquabeads jewel starter set playing

There are 5 different templates and also a 3D creations template set including a pencil-holder and a photo frame. After trying out the template, Mr K decided to freestyle. So he made a hexagon shape coaster.

Aqua beads Jewel Starter Set contents

After he created a design, simply fill the sprayer with water and spray the water mist onto the beads. Wait for at least an hour to dry before removing it from the tray. I find it quite hard to know how much water to spray. So trying to take it off without breaking is the most tricky part of this craft.   Sometimes, the water mist didn’t reach some parts of the area, so the beads on the side tend to drop off without sticking. When I put too much water, it take a long time to dry (1 – 2 hours) and the back of the bead design becomes soggy to touch after removing it from the tray. It is quite hard to adjust the amount of water to get it right. I think this maybe something that comes with experience – the more you do it, the better you get at judging this. Also one thing to note is that, when the design is sprayed with water, you won’t be able to use the tray until it has dried. So if you have more than one child wanting to design something, they won’t be able to straight away. My daughter was quite disappointed but after an hour or so to allow Mr K’s design to dry, she was ready to make her own!

Aqua beads Jewel Starter Set freestyle

The designs look fantastic and my son loved his. He enjoyed the flexibility of following a template or creating his own design. They are available in Amazon and all good toy shops. I would recommend them for independent creative play.
